The cycle of addiction is the repetitive pattern people with addiction often experience. It happens in certain stages or phases, but the specifics of the cycle vary depending on the substance or behavior involved.
Key Features of Addiction
Not sure whether you or a loved one are addicted? Here are a few of the key features of addiction:
An inability to control substance use
Constant cravings
Increased tolerance to substances
Negative consequences like legal issues or relationship problems

Why You Need to Know About the Pink Cloud
The first few days of sobriety can be overwhelming. Some face difficult withdrawal symptoms. Others face intense cravings for the substance they abused. Getting through these first steps is hard, but it’s necessary for a brighter future.
After the initial discomfort, some people in recovery enter a period of improvement known in the addiction treatment community as “the pink cloud” or “pink cloud syndrome.” It’s the feeling that nothing can stop their progress and that relapse isn’t possible. Addiction is a complex and chronic condition. It involves the compulsive use of a substance or engagement in an activity despite harmful consequences. It’s considered a disorder because it involves changes in the brain’s reward and motivation systems. This leads to an intense and often uncontrollable craving. Addiction can involve a substance or a behavior.
Some common substances that lead to addiction include:
Alcohol
Nicotine
Prescription drugs
Stimulants
Some common behaviors that can lead to addiction include:
Gambling
Shopping
Eating
Social media/internet use
Sex
Pornography
